About Rolf Ziegler

Rolf Ziegler is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Aquatic Science and Insect Science, having authored 31 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neurobiology and Insect Physiology Research (24 papers), Physiological and biochemical adaptations (9 papers) and Insect Utilization and Effects (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Insect Science (525 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(690 citations) and Aquatic Science (95 citations). Rolf Ziegler has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Mohab Ibrahim, Klaus Eckart, G.R. Wyatt, John H. Law, Rainer Keller, Helmut Schwarz, Ronald D. Jasensky, Hiromi Morimoto, Ann M. Fallon and Masaaki Ashida.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, The FASEB Journal and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ications.
